There was no probs with anybody who did the Coast 2 Coast as that was in England. But I went on the  seven's 'how the west was driven' tour last year in my V8 all I did was change the advance slightly to cope with the crap petrol out there otherwise  I /we didn't have any issues

You are correct in your assumption. A temporary import does not have to comply with US regulations.
